refactor: Remove hooks - SessionEnd/PreCompact not useful for notifications
Hooks execute after Claude Code exits, so output is not visible. Removed: setup command, install-hooks.sh, hooks.json, session-end-reminder.sh Bump version to 2.2.0 🤖 Generated with [Claude Code](https://claude.com/claude-code)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
This commit is contained in:
@@ -1,62 +0,0 @@
|
||||
# /learn:setup - Install Learn Plugin Hooks
|
||||
|
||||
Instalează hooks-urile plugin-ului Learn în configurația Claude Code.
|
||||
|
||||
## Task
|
||||
|
||||
Verifică și instalează hooks-urile necesare pentru plugin-ul Learn în `~/.claude/settings.json`.
|
||||
|
||||
### Hooks de instalat:
|
||||
|
||||
1. **SessionEnd** - Reminder la sfârșitul sesiunii să rulezi `/learn:analyze`
|
||||
2. **PreCompact** (auto) - Reminder înainte de auto-compact să salvezi lecțiile
|
||||
|
||||
### Pași:
|
||||
|
||||
1. Citește `~/.claude/settings.json`
|
||||
2. Verifică dacă există deja secțiunea `hooks`
|
||||
3. Adaugă sau actualizează hooks-urile pentru Learn plugin:
|
||||
|
||||
```json
|
||||
{
|
||||
"hooks": {
|
||||
"SessionEnd": [
|
||||
{
|
||||
"hooks": [
|
||||
{
|
||||
"type": "command",
|
||||
"command": "echo 'Tip: Ruleaza /learn:analyze pentru a captura lectiile din sesiune'",
|
||||
"timeout": 5
|
||||
}
|
||||
]
|
||||
}
|
||||
],
|
||||
"PreCompact": [
|
||||
{
|
||||
"matcher": "auto",
|
||||
"hooks": [
|
||||
{
|
||||
"type": "command",
|
||||
"command": "echo 'Context plin! Ruleaza /learn:analyze ACUM pentru a salva lectiile inainte de compact!'",
|
||||
"timeout": 5
|
||||
}
|
||||
]
|
||||
}
|
||||
]
|
||||
}
|
||||
}
|
||||
```
|
||||
|
||||
4. Salvează fișierul actualizat
|
||||
5. Confirmă instalarea cu succes
|
||||
|
||||
### Output:
|
||||
|
||||
Afișează:
|
||||
- Ce hooks au fost instalate
|
||||
- Dacă erau deja instalate (skip)
|
||||
- Instrucțiuni pentru a verifica cu `/hooks`
|
||||
|
||||
### Notă:
|
||||
|
||||
Această comandă modifică `~/.claude/settings.json`. Hooks-urile vor fi active din următoarea sesiune Claude Code.
|
||||
Reference in New Issue
Block a user